参考答案和解析
正确答案:B
解析:SIGN()函数返回指定表达式的符号;ABS()是求绝对值的函数;SQRT()函数用来求指定表达式的平方根。
更多“执行下列语句,其函数结果为STORE-100 TO X?SIGN(X) * SQRT(ABS(X))A.10B.-10C.l00D.-100 ”相关问题
  • 第1题:

    若有代数式

    (其中e仅代表自然对数的底数,不是变量),则以下能够正确表示该代数式的C语言表达式是( )。

    A.sqrt(abs(n^x+e^x))

    B.sqrt(fabs(pow(n,x)+pow(x,e)'))

    C.sqrt(fabs(pow(n,x)+exp(x,e)))

    D.sqrt(fabs(pow(x,n)+exp(x)))


    正确答案:C
    解析:exp()函数的功能是返回以自然数e为底、函数参数x为幂的指数值ex;pow(n,x)函数是计算nx;fabs()函数功能是返回函数参数的绝对值;sqrt()用于返回函数参数的平方根。选项A中的n^x不是有效的C语言表达式;选项B中powr(x,e)的功能是求xe值,显然也不正确;选项D中的pow(n,x)存在和选项B相同的问题。

  • 第2题:

    在没有导入标准库math的情况下,语句x = 3 or math.sqrt(9)也可以正常执行,并且执行后x的值为3。


    错误

  • 第3题:

    sign()是符号函数,变量X的值为1000,则表达式10 <= X | 100 = =sign(-100) 的值为

    A.1000

    B.100

    C.False

    D.True


    True

  • 第4题:

    下列程序的执行结果是______。 X=-6^2 Print Sgn(x)+Abs(x)+Int(x)

    A.-36

    B.1

    C.-1

    D.-72


    正确答案:C

  • 第5题:

    在没有导入标准库math的情况下,语句x = 3 and math.sqrt(9)也可以正常执行,并且执行后x的值为3。


    错误